Gender and the Screen

April Austen and Nick Angus

6 Episodes

In this podcast, we explore the issue of gender diversity in the Australian screen industry, particularly focusing on the representation of women in behind the camera roles. So that’s directors, producers, writers and cinematographers, to name a few.

Throughout this series, we will be talking to female and male creatives and academics about their experiences with gender diversity.

Why is gender diversity essential to the future of the screen industry and of storytelling? What can be done to further champion equality?

Hosted by Nick Angus and April Austen. Music by Jason Markoutsas.
